wayward airbag dash warning light
« on: Apr 2nd, 2012, 11:14am » |
Quote Modify
|
greetings, is there a circuit diagram available for this system. the illumination can be quite intermittent , a bump in the road causing it to go off as well as bringing it on. it may seem daft but can it be affected by R/T. on the motorway nearby there is an electronic traffic monitoring array. the light can be off but you can guarantee that when the position is passed the light pops up ! there again it could be a bad connection somewhere, duff sensor ? any advice gratefully received

There have been several posts regarding a flickering airbag light over the years. Faults with components of the airbag system or their wiring should produce a flashing code as shown on the page that Simmo posted a link to. A flickering or permanently on light is more likely to be either the power supply to the airbag module, a fault with the module or its connector/wiring to the dash, the dash connector or the dash itself. Quite often with this problem people report slapping the top of the dash or pressing the instrument cluster will cause it to come on/go off. Cleaning the connector behind the dash is often suggested, but as that connector has 6 other wires it is difficult to see why just the airbag light would be commonly affected – although having said that there are less common reports of problems with the cruise light, its pin is adjacent to the airbag pin. I have found bad solder joints in the dash of my car & have had no problems since re-soldering them, however it was only a few weeks ago so difficult to say whether it was definitely the fault. I plan to post more about it at some stage. Yes plugs link to pyrotechnic pre-tensioners, although I believe early cars may not have pyrotechnic types. Later cars also have side airbags but I don’t know the location of the plugs. You should find clips under the seats to keep the plugs out of harms way. The plugs & sleeving for the wires for the system are yellow. On this page it says “disconnecting the battery for twenty minutes”: http://www.fordscorpio.co.uk/airbagmanual.htm However within the PDF’s it says “Wait at least 15 minutes after disconnecting the battery before disconnecting the electronic control module multiplug. For all other supplementary restraint system multiplugs wait two minutes. If these times are not observed there may be the possibility of accidentally deploying the air bag(s) and the pyrotechnic seat belt pre-tensioners.”

My scorpio did the same but the flickering went of for moments if i slapped the dashboard... it bothered me so finally i changed the instrument panel and the airbag light flicker disappeared like magic... also i looked at the old instrument panel for cold solders and there were some so i think that were where the flickers originated.
